[From introduction on inside of front cover] No other artist has had as great an impact on popular culture in America as did Maxfield Parrish (1870 - 1966). His images appeared everywhere - as illustrations in children's books and in such leading periodicals as Scribner's Magazine, Life, Collier's, St. Nicholas, Ladies' Home Journal, Hearst's Magazine and Harper's Weekly; as advertisements for everything from bicycles to Jell-O, cosmetics to chocolates; as greeting cards; as seventeen successive calendars for General Electric Edison Mazda Lamps as well as other calendars; even as menus and bulletin boards. But it was his art prints that brought Parrish the greatest public acclaim: their popularity was immediate and enormous, creating a previously unparalleled demand. Reproduced in full color in this book are eight of Maxfield Parrish's finest works: The Dinkey-Bird, Air Castles, Daybreak, The Manager Draws the Curtain, Land of Make-Believe, The Lantern Bearers, Puss-in-Boots and a graduation painting from the Pennsylvania Academy of the Fine Arts. The pop-up format adds a third dimension and a touch of whimsy to Parrish's magnificent paintings and offers a fresh perspective on these timeless classics.
